Overview
Two clinic locations — one in Katy, one in Cypress — give families in the western Houston suburbs convenient access to pediatric speech, occupational, and feeding therapy. Therapists work with children of all ages, and the practice also sends clinicians directly to ABA centers throughout North and West Houston, so kids already enrolled elsewhere can receive coordinated care. Every new client starts with a structured evaluation covering parent input, observation, and formal testing before a personalized treatment plan is built.
Children in the Katy or Cypress area who need speech, OT, or feeding support and whose families want a clinic that can coordinate visits directly at their ABA center.
Sessions open with movement to help children regulate before targeting communication, sensory, or motor goals — a deliberate sequence built on the principle that a calm nervous system learns better. The team works across disciplines, shares home exercises through a HIPAA-secure messaging app, and actively involves parents at every stage.
A doctor's referral (faxed to 832-261-9945) is preferred but parents can also self-refer by calling or emailing the clinic. Most commercial insurance plans are accepted, including Blue Cross Blue Shield, Cigna, UnitedHealthcare, and Community Health Choice; private-pay rates are available on request.

Their pediatric OT supports sensory integration, fine motor, feeding, self-regulation and ADLs. Sessions are play-based, so they feel like fun to your child while building real, everyday skills.
Yes — Play Makes Sensory Pediatric Therapy has experience with AAC (augmentative and alternative communication) for nonverbal and minimally verbal children. AAC ranges from picture boards to speech-generating devices, matched to each child.
